Pawan Kalyan offers special prayers at Kondagattu temple shrine in Jagtial district

K M Dayashankar

Temple EO submits a memorandum urging allocation of TTD funds for the development of Kondagattu shrine

JAGTIAL, JUNE 29, 2024: Andhra Pradesh state Deputy Chief Minister and Jana Sena Party president Konedala Pawan Kalyan has offered special prayers to presiding deity Lord Hanuman at Sri Anjaneya Swamy devasthanam in Kondagattu of Jagtial district on Saturday.

As soon as he arrived at the temple shrine, Collector B Satya Prasad, SP Ashok Kumar, RDO Madhusudhan welcomed Mr Kalyan by presenting him with flower bouquets. The temple priests have accorded traditional ‘poornakumbham’ welcome amid chanting of vedic hymns to the actor-turned-politician, who made a maiden visit to the temple shrine after assuming charge as the Deputy CM of AP state.

Mr Pawan Kalyan, who is on Varahi deeksha, offered special prayers to the deity. Later, the priests and temple EO presented the prasadam and portrait of the shrine. On this occasion, temple EO Chandrashekhar submitted a petition urging the AP deputy CM to allocate TTD funds for the development of Kondagattu temple such as construction of 100-rooms accommodation facilities and deeksha mandapam.

Following the arrival of powerstar Pawan Kalyan, his fans arrived in large numbers to the temple shrine to have a glimpse of their hero. The police had a tough time in regulating the surging crowds and resorted to mild lathi-charge to disperse the mob.  Jagtial DSP Raghuchander, Malllial CI Neelam Ravi supervised the security arrangements.
